Ajustes na Tela Inicial

<< Clique para Mostrar o Sumário >>

 

Ajustes na Tela Inicial

1.Expanda o nodo da Tela scrInicial e clique com o botão direito do mouse na Consulta cnsMoenda. Selecione a opção Configurar.

2.Selecione o Driver drvEPM_UA como fonte de dados da Consulta.

3.Na janela de configuração, selecione a opção Dados Processados no grupo Tipo de leitura e adicione o Tag EficMoenda. Digite "EficMoenda" na coluna Título e selecione o item TimeAverage na coluna Função.

Consulta cnsMoenda

Consulta cnsMoenda

4.Na aba Variáveis, configure os parâmetros StartTime, EndTime e TimeInterval com os valores "01/01/2014", "01/01/2015" e "2592000", respectivamente. Em seguida, clique em OK.

5.Configure as Consultas cnsFermCaldo, cnsFermMel e cnsDestilacao da mesma forma que a Consulta cnsMoenda, substituindo os Tags para EficFermentacaoCaldo, EficFermentacaoMel e EficDestilacao, respectivamente.

6.Adicione no evento Change do objeto cbSafra (que é a lista para seleção da safra) o script a seguir. Este script atualiza o período de cada Consulta e as utiliza para a atualização dos gráficos.

Screen.SetFocus()
Status = "Carregando..."
Screen.Item("lblEficSafraMoenda").Value = Status
Screen.Item("lblEficSafraFermCaldo").Value = Status
Screen.Item("lblEficSafraFermMel").Value = Status
Screen.Item("lblEficSafraDest").Value = Status
consultas = Array("cnsMoenda", "cnsFermCaldo", "cnsFermMel", "cnsDestilacao")
Safra = Value
For Each consulta In consultas
  Screen.Item(consulta).SetVariableValue "StartTime", "01/01/" & Safra
  Screen.Item(consulta).SetVariableValue "EndTime", "01/01/" & Safra + 1
  Screen.Item(consulta).GetAsyncADORecordset()
Next

 

7.Salve a Tela scrInicial.

Esta página foi útil?